# Break-Glass: Catalog Cache Invalidation

Scope: the Pinrow product catalog at Veldstone Retail. If stale prices persist after a purge and the Hollowmere invalidation queue is wedged, use break-glass to flush the edge tier directly. Contractors: get verbal sign-off from the catalog lead first. Steps: open the Hollowmere admin shell, select emergency-flush, confirm the tenant, and run it once — repeated flushes thrash the origin. Access is logged and expires after 20 minutes. Unseal the admin shell with the passphrase below.

recovery phrase for kahop-tajog: istix-casvan

Subject: DR Drill — User Module Extraction (Coppervine Platform)

Dear plugin authors,

Next Thursday we will run a disaster-recovery drill covering the newly extracted user module, split from the Coppervine monolith. During the drill window, user-lookup APIs may briefly return stale data; please ensure your plugins handle this gracefully. If your sandbox tenant fails over and locks, use the recovery tool, entering the passphrase shown below.

vault phrase of tawig-taduf = zorath-oliwyn

Runbook: Seatlattice Renderer — Release Checks

Before promoting a Seatlattice build, confirm the seat-map renderer for the Marlowe Hall layout draws all 1,842 seats with correct pricing tiers and accessibility markers. Run the visual diff suite against the golden images; any pixel variance above the threshold blocks release. Cache invalidation must complete before the promote step. The renderer's production configuration is listed below.

settings of yagag-kahop:
FENWYN_PIN=6385
FENWYN_METRICS_HOST=metrics.fenwyn.nelvrolabs.corp
FENWYN_LOG_LEVEL=error
FENWYN_TENANT=casok